Web17 dec. 2024 · Such stereoisomers that are not mirror images are called diastereomers. Typically, you can only have diastereomers when the molecule has two or more chiral centers. The maximum number of possible stereoisomers that a molecule can have is a function of 2 n , where n is the number of chiral centers in the molecule.
